The weakly nonlinear interaction of sound and linearly polarized Alfvén waves propagating along an applied magnetic field is studied in the case when the sound and Alfvén speeds are equal. The sound wave is coupled to an Alfvén wave with double period and wavelength. The Alfvén wave drives the sound wave due to the ponderomotive force, while the sound wave returns the energy back to the Alfvén wave through the swing wave-wave interaction (Zaqarashvili, 2001). As a result, the waves alternately exchange their energy during the propagation. The process of energy exchange is faster for waves with stronger amplitudes. The phenomenon can be of importance in the solar atmosphere, solar wind and other astrophysical situations.
